Chapter 132a - State Recreation Areas Outside of the Metropolitan Parks District
Section 11 - Conservation Program for Cities and Towns; Establishment

Section 11. The secretary of environmental affairs shall establish a program to assist the cities and towns, which have established conservation commissions under section eight C of chapter forty, in acquiring lands and in planning or designing suitable public outdoor facilities as described in sections two B and two D. He may, from funds appropriated to carry out the provisions of section three, reimburse any such city or town for any money expended by it in establishing an approved project under said program in such amount as he shall determine to be equitable in consideration of anticipated benefits from such project, but in no event shall the amount of such reimbursement exceed eighty per cent of the cost of such project. No reimbursement shall be made hereunder to a city or town unless a project application is filed by such city or town with the secretary setting forth such plans and information as the secretary may require and approved by him, nor until such city or town shall have appropriated, transferred from available funds or have voted to expend from its conservation fund, under clause fifty-one of section five of chapter forty, an amount equal to the total cost of the project, nor until the project has been completed, to the satisfaction of the secretary, in accordance with said approved plans. Any reimbursement received by a city or town under this section shall be applied to the payment of indebtedness, if any, incurred in acquiring land for such conservation project.
